Market Overview
The European warranty management system market covers software solutions that automate and optimize the administration of product warranties from point of sale through end-of-life, encompassing claim adjudication, service network management, parts and labor cost control, and predictive analytics. At $2.8 billion in 2025, the market spans industries including automotive, industrial machinery, consumer electronics, and heavy equipment, with demand accelerating as European manufacturers digitize after-sales operations. Adoption has been fueled by the recognition that efficient warranty management directly impacts profitability, warranty costs typically represent between one and three percent of revenue for manufacturers, making optimization a high-priority business initiative.

Growth Drivers
The electric vehicle transition is a dominant catalyst, as battery packs and electric drivetrains introduce new warranty risk profiles requiring real-time monitoring, remote diagnostics, and predictive failure modeling that legacy systems cannot provide. Concurrently, the proliferation of IoT-connected products generates streams of operational data that enable condition-based warranty assessments and proactive service interventions. Stringent European Union regulations, including updated product safety directives and consumer rights frameworks, mandate comprehensive warranty traceability and faster claims resolution timelines.

Segmentation and Regional Analysis
Western Europe, particularly Germany, France, and the United Kingdom, accounts for the largest share of the market, driven by strong automotive and industrial manufacturing bases with mature digital infrastructure. Central and Eastern European markets are growing at an accelerating pace as regional manufacturers upgrade legacy systems and align with EU regulatory standards. Cloud-based deployment has overtaken on-premises solutions as the preferred architecture, with modular SaaS platforms gaining traction among mid-sized manufacturers seeking flexible, subscription-based pricing.

Trends and Outlook
What are the recent trends and outlook?
Artificial intelligence and machine learning are increasingly embedded in warranty platforms to detect anomalous claims patterns, automate adjudication decisions, and forecast warranty reserve requirements with greater accuracy. Blockchain technology is being piloted for immutable warranty record-keeping, particularly in automotive applications where vehicle history and service provenance must be verifiable across ownership changes. The shift toward product-as-a-service and outcome-based business models is blurring the boundary between warranty and subscription services, prompting platform vendors to develop unified customer lifecycle management capabilities.
